Level 585mยฒ block in Burwood East | Quiet street near shops and schools | 3-bedroom family house with expansion scope | Strong location for owner-occupiers
This property presents a compelling entry point into Burwood Eastโs family market, where a level 585mยฒ allotment on a quiet street is increasingly rare. The houseโs 36% building coverage leaves meaningful potential for future extension or reconfiguration, while the L-shaped lounge and kitchen-meals layout suit a buyer seeking a solid starter home in a well-connected pocket. Proximity to Burwood One, primary and secondary schools, and tram routes to Deakin University positions it strongly for families or investors targeting long-term rental demand from students and professionals.
The primary risk lies in the single bathroom and dated interior, which may require immediate updating to meet modern expectations and could limit initial appeal to some buyers. No heritage or flood overlays reduce approval complexity for renovations, but the lack of recent sales history means comparable evidence is thin. The opportunity is in the land-to-building ratio: a buyer willing to invest in a bathroom addition or rear extension could unlock significant value, particularly given the suburbโs stable demographic profile and consistent rental yields around $650 per week.

Market Insight:
Burwood East is a family-oriented suburb with a robust housing market, evidenced by strong auction clearance rates and consistent sales volumes. Demand is primarily driven by families seeking larger homes, supported by the demographic profile. House prices demonstrate steady annual growth, while the unit market shows more variable performance and longer selling periods. Future growth is underpinned by sustained family demand, though affordability constraints at current price points and a recent dip in sales volume present potential headwinds for the market’s momentum.
